Band D council tax in Scotland
In Clackmannanshire, band D council tax in Scotland rose from £1,148 in the year ending March 2017 to £1,684 in the year ending March 2027, a change of £536 or 46.7%, in cash terms, not adjusted for inflation (Scottish Government).

Median annual pay, full-time employees, by area of residence
In Clackmannanshire, median annual pay, full-time employees, by area of residence rose from £26,428 in 2017 to £36,259 in 2025, a change of £9,831 or 37.2%, in cash terms, not adjusted for inflation (ONS).

Civometry · Clackmannanshire - £103,795January 2017£165,884June 2026
In Clackmannanshire, average house price rose from £103,795 in January 2017 to £165,884 in June 2026, a change of £62,089 or 59.8%, in cash terms, not adjusted for inflation (HM Land Registry).

Civometry · Clackmannanshire - 51,630Mid-201752,110Mid-2024
In Clackmannanshire, population by local authority rose from 51,630 in Mid-2017 to 52,110 in Mid-2024, a change of 480 or 0.9% (ONS).
